A+Technical Description
The DALIAN DL-25 (M) is a precision horizontal turning center engineered for high-performance metal machining operations. This slant bed CNC lathe features a robust one-piece casting construction with a 45-degree slant bed design, delivering exceptional rigidity and stability. The machine accommodates workpieces up to 12.2 inches in swing diameter and 39.4 inches in turning length, with a maximum bar capacity of 3 inches when equipped with the through-hole hydraulic chuck. The primary spindle operates at 3,500 RPM with 25 horsepower, providing adequate cutting torque for heavy-duty applications. The 10-inch chuck diameter ensures secure workpiece clamping across various component geometries. The 12-position hydraulic turret tool changer enables rapid tool indexing with adjacent tool changeover times of approximately 0.45 seconds, optimizing cycle times. Linear X and Z axis travel capabilities of 10.23 and 21.26 inches respectively, coupled with rapid traverse rates of 473 IPM, facilitate efficient part movement and positioning. The CNC control system utilizes either FANUC 0i-TF Plus or SIEMENS 828D technology, providing advanced programming flexibility and precision machining capabilities. Positioning accuracy of ±0.011 inches and repeatability of ±0.004 inches meet stringent tolerance requirements for demanding applications. At 7,800 kilograms, the machine provides substantial mass for vibration dampening. This configuration makes the DL-25 (M) ideal for precision shaft turning, disc machining, and complex component production requiring extended cutting length and reliable automation.
